ABBV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2016 in Review

1,653 of the 3,748 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in AbbVie (ABBV) for Q3 2016, worth a combined $69.4B — down 0.65% from $69.9B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 102 funds opened new ABBV positions and 65 closed out — a net gain of 37 holders — while 631 added to existing stakes and 661 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Capital Research Global Investors, adding an estimated $554M. The largest seller was Bank of America, cutting an estimated $768M.
